{"id":22938127,"url":"https://github.com/zeeshanahmad4/webscrapesummarizer","last_synced_at":"2025-10-25T20:10:14.090Z","repository":{"id":191800038,"uuid":"685426580","full_name":"Zeeshanahmad4/WebScrapeSummarizer","owner":"Zeeshanahmad4","description":"WebScrapeSummarizer 🌐✍️: A web tool that fetches and summarizes content from any domain, offering insights in a compact CSV format.","archived":false,"fork":false,"pushed_at":"2023-09-06T08:44:19.000Z","size":39,"stargazers_count":3,"open_issues_count":0,"forks_count":1,"subscribers_count":2,"default_branch":"main","last_synced_at":"2025-04-15T21:34:13.927Z","etag":null,"topics":["contentsummarization","csv","dataprocessing","naturallanguageprocessing","nlp","openai","php","tools","webdevelopment","webscraping","webtool"],"latest_commit_sha":null,"homepage":"","language":"JavaScript","has_issues":true,"has_wiki":null,"has_pages":null,"mirror_url":null,"source_name":null,"license":null,"status":null,"scm":"git","pull_requests_enabled":true,"icon_url":"https://github.com/Zeeshanahmad4.png","metadata":{"files":{"readme":"README.md","changelog":null,"contributing":null,"funding":null,"license":null,"code_of_conduct":null,"threat_model":null,"audit":null,"citation":null,"codeowners":null,"security":null,"support":null,"governance":null,"roadmap":null,"authors":null,"dei":null,"publiccode":null,"codemeta":null}},"created_at":"2023-08-31T07:49:38.000Z","updated_at":"2024-10-03T05:17:39.000Z","dependencies_parsed_at":"2025-02-07T12:45:37.829Z","dependency_job_id":null,"html_url":"https://github.com/Zeeshanahmad4/WebScrapeSummarizer","commit_stats":null,"previous_names":["zeeshanahmad4/webscrapesummarizer"],"tags_count":0,"template":false,"template_full_name":null,"purl":"pkg:github/Zeeshanahmad4/WebScrapeSummarizer","repository_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/Zeeshanahmad4%2FWebScrapeSummarizer","tags_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/Zeeshanahmad4%2FWebScrapeSummarizer/tags","releases_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/Zeeshanahmad4%2FWebScrapeSummarizer/releases","manifests_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/Zeeshanahmad4%2FWebScrapeSummarizer/manifests","owner_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ners/Zeeshanahmad4","download_url":"https://codeload.github.com/Zeeshanahmad4/WebScrapeSummarizer/tar.gz/refs/heads/main","sbom_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ories/Zeeshanahmad4%2FWebScrapeSummarizer/sbom","host":{"name":"GitHub","url":"https://github.com","kind":"github","repositories_count":265024005,"owners_count":23699585,"icon_url":"https://github.com/github.png","version":null,"created_at":"2022-05-30T11:31:42.601Z","updated_at":"2022-07-04T15:15:14.044Z","host_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ub","repositories_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repositories","repository_names_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/repository_names","owners_url":"https://repos.ecosyste.ms/api/v1/hosts/GitHub/owners"}},"keywords":["contentsummarization","csv","dataprocessing","naturallanguageprocessing","nlp","openai","php","tools","webdevelopment","webscraping","webtool"],"created_at":"2024-12-14T12:16:08.617Z","updated_at":"2025-10-25T20:10:09.055Z","avatar_url":"https://github.com/Zeeshanahmad4.png","language":"JavaScript","funding_links":[],"categories":[],"sub_categories":[],"readme":"\u003ch1 align=\"center\"\u003eWebScrapeSummarizer 🌐✍️\u003c/h1\u003e\n\n\u003cdiv align=\"center\"\u003e\n  \u003ca href=\"https://mail.google.com/mail/u/?authuser=ahmadzee26@gmail.com\"\u003e\n    \u003cimg alt=\"Gmail\" width=\"30px\" src=\"https://edent.github.io/SuperTinyIcons/images/svg/gmail.svg\" /\u003e\n    \u003ccode\u003eahmadzee26@gmail.com\u003c/code\u003e\n  \u003c/a\u003e\n  \u003cspan\u003e ┃ \u003c/span\u003e\n  \n  \u003ca href=\"https://t.me/zeeshanahmad4\"\u003e\n    \u003cimg alt=\"Telegram\" width=\"30px\" src=\"https://edent.github.io/SuperTinyIcons/images/svg/telegram.svg\" /\u003e\n    \u003ccode\u003e@zeeshanahmad4\u003c/code\u003e\n  \u003c/a\u003e\n  \u003cspan\u003e ┃ \u003c/span\u003e\n  \n  \u003ca href=\"https://discord.com\"\u003e\n    \u003cimg alt=\"Discord\" width=\"30px\" src=\"https://github.com/Zeeshanahmad4/RealEstateMate-WhatsApp-Group-Management-Bot/blob/main/discord-icon-svgrepo-com.svg\" /\u003e\n    \u003ccode\u003ezee#2655\u003c/code\u003e\n  \u003c/a\u003e\n  \u003cspan\u003e ┃ \u003c/span\u003e\n  \n  \u003ca href=\"https://www.upwork.com/freelancers/zeeshanahmad291\"\u003e\n    \u003cimg alt=\"Upwork\" width=\"80px\" src=\"https://github.com/Zeeshanahmad4/Zeeshanahmad4/blob/main/upwork.svg\" /\u003e\n    \u003ccode\u003eZeeshan Ahmad\u003c/code\u003e\n  \u003c/a\u003e\n  \n  \u003cbr /\u003e\n  \u003cstrong\u003eFor discussion, queries, and freelance work. Do reach me.👆👆👆\u003c/strong\u003e\n\u003c/div\u003e\n\n### Table of Contents\n\n1. [Project Overview](https://github.com/Zeeshanahmad4/WebScrapeSummarizer#project-overview-)\n    - [WebScrapeSummarizer Description](https://github.com/Zeeshanahmad4/WebScrapeSummarizer#project-overview-)\n2. [Features](https://github.com/Zeeshanahmad4/WebScrapeSummarizer#features-)\n     - [Future Enhancements (To-Do)](https://github.com/Zeeshanahmad4/WebScrapeSummarizer#-future-enhancements-to-do)\n4. [Usage Examples](https://github.com/Zeeshanahmad4/WebScrapeSummarizer#usage-examples-)\n    - [Summarize Web Content](https://github.com/Zeeshanahmad4/WebScrapeSummarizer#usage-examples-)\n6. [Troubleshooting Tips](https://github.com/Zeeshanahmad4/WebScrapeSummarizer#troubleshooting-tips-)\n7. [Contribution Guidelines](https://github.com/Zeeshanahmad4/WebScrapeSummarizer#contribution-guidelines-)\n\n\n### Project Overview 📑\n\n**WebScrapeSummarizer** is a web-based tool that allows users to input a domain, scrapes the content of that domain, processes the content with OpenAI to generate a summary, and then saves the summarized data into a CSV file.\n\n### Features 🌟\n\n- **Domain Input**: A clean user interface to input the domain of interest.\n- **Web Scraping**: Efficiently fetches content from the provided domain.\n- **OpenAI Integration**: Uses OpenAI's API to process and summarize the scraped content.\n- **CSV Output**: Generates a CSV file with the summarized data.\n\n  #### 🚀 Future Enhancements (To-Do):\n\n- Integrate more web scraping capabilities to fetch meta tags, images, and other essential content.\n- Provide visual analytics and insights based on the scraped data.\n- Allow users to schedule periodic scraping and summary generation.\n- Add support for multiple file formats for output (e.g., JSON, XML).\n- Integrate with other NLP tools for different types of content processing.\n\n\n### Usage Examples 📖\n\n1. **Summarize Web Content**:\n    - Navigate to the WebScrapeSummarizer homepage.\n    - Input the domain of your choice.\n    - Click on \"Process\".\n    - Download the generated CSV file with the summarized content.\n\n  ### Setup and Installation Instructions 🛠️\n\n   ```git clone https://github.com/YOUR_GITHUB_USERNAME/WebScrapeSummarizer.git ```\n   \n   Navigate to the project directory:\n   \n  ```cd WebScrapeSummarizer ```\n\n- Set up your OpenAI API credentials in `libs/openai.php`.\n- Host the tool on a server with PHP support.\n- Navigate to the tool's URL in your browser and start using it!\n\n ### Troubleshooting Tips 🚫\n\n - **API Errors**: Ensure that your OpenAI API key is correctly set in `libs/openai.php`.\n- **Domain Input Errors**: Ensure the domain is in a valid format and is accessible.\n- **CSV Output Errors**: Check permissions on the server to ensure the CSV can be written to the desired directory.\n\n\n  ### Contribution Guidelines 🤝\n\nWe welcome contributions! If you'd like to improve **WebScrapeSummarizer** or add features:\n\n1. Fork the repository.\n2. Create a new branch for your feature or fix.\n3. Submit a pull request, and it will be reviewed by the maintainers.\n\n","project_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fzeeshanahmad4%2Fwebscrapesummarizer","html_url":"https://awesome.ecosyste.ms/projects/github.com%2Fzeeshanahmad4%2Fwebscrapesummarizer","lists_url":"https://awesome.ecosyste.ms/api/v1/projects/github.com%2Fzeeshanahmad4%2Fwebscrapesummarizer/lists"}